Q: Is 33,400,178 a Composite Number?

 A: Yes, 33,400,178 is a composite number.

Why is 33,400,178 a composite number?

A composite number is a number that can be divided evenly by more numbers than 1 and itself. It is the opposite of a prime number.

The number 33,400,178 can be evenly divided by 1 2 7 14 2,385,727 4,771,454 16,700,089 and 33,400,178, with no remainder.

Since 33,400,178 cannot be divided by just 1 and 33,400,178, it is a composite number.
